Addressing Misalignment
Misaligned French doors can cause difficulties in closing or opening. Here's how to fix this concern:
Identify the Misalignment: Check if the doors are sitting uniformly within the frame. If one door is greater than the other, it might need adjusting.Adjust the Hinges: Using a screwdriver, tighten up or loosen the screws on the hinges. If modifications are insufficient, you might require to rearrange the hinges.Examine the Frame: If the frame has actually settled, think about using shims to adjust the alignment.2. Sealing for Energy Efficiency
Drafts and leakages can cause increased energy costs. To guarantee your doors are sealed correctly:
Inspect Weather Stripping: Over time, weather condition removing can break. Eliminate old stripping and replace it with brand-new material created to fit your door.Look for Gaps: Use a flashlight to recognize any spaces. Squeaky hinges can be an inconvenience, but they are easily repaired:
Choose the Right Lubricant: Use a silicone-based lube or graphite powder. Prevent oil-based lubricants, as they can attract dirt.Apply the Lubricant: Spray or use the lubricant on the hinges, then open and close the door a number of times to distribute it.Tools Needed for Fixing French Doors

A1: Difficulty in closing can be due to misalignment, inflamed doors from humidity, or issues with the locking mechanism.
Q2: How often should I lube my French door hinges?
A2: It's recommended to lubricate the hinges a minimum of when a year, or more frequently if you discover squeaking.
Q3: What is the very best weather condition removing for French doors?
A3: Foam tape weather stripping is a great option for attaining a tight seal; however, for much better insulation, consider using V-strip or magnetic weather condition strips.
Q4: Can I change the locks on my French doors myself?
A4: Yes, changing locks is a straightforward procedure. Guarantee you have the right tools and follow maker directions.
Q5: What should I do if my doors are still misaligned after modifications?
A5: If modifications do not resolve misalignment, consider consulting a professional. The problem might be because of a settling foundation or a requirement for brand-new hinges.
